Step 1: Scripting with a Prompt Framework

A strong case study video script follows the Problem-Agitate-Solution (PAS) framework and is typically 225-250 words for a 90-second final cut. You can generate a first draft using a writing assistant like Jasper AI or the built-in script generator in some video tools.

Use a detailed prompt, such as: "Write a 250-word video script for a business case study about our client, Acme Corp. Problem: They had a 45% customer churn rate.

Agitate: This cost them $500k in ARR. Solution: Using our software, they reduced churn to 15% in Q1 2026 by identifying at-risk accounts." This specificity is critical.

The AI needs concrete numbers to produce a compelling narrative. Always review the AI's output to inject your brand's tone and ensure the client's story is told accurately.

A human review takes less than 10 minutes and is the most important part of the scripting phase.

Step 2: Generating Voiceover and Sourcing Visuals

Once the script is final, you generate the audio track with a text-to-speech (TTS) tool. Modern TTS engines produce natural-sounding narration, a significant improvement over the robotic voices from a few years ago.

You can then select stock footage, screen recordings, or animated charts to match the narration. Most AI video platforms include access to stock libraries like Storyblocks or Pexels as part of their monthly fee.

For screen recordings, tools like Loom or Tella are effective. A key detail is pacing: aim for one new visual element on screen every 3-5 seconds to maintain viewer engagement.

Step 3: Assembling, Branding, and Adding Captions

The assembly stage is where you combine the script, voiceover, and visuals into a cohesive video. AI video editors present your script as a series of scenes, automatically suggesting footage for each sentence.

You can quickly swap these suggestions with your own uploads, like a client logo or a product screenshot. At this stage, you apply your brand kit: logo watermarks, brand fonts, and color overlays.

Step 4: Distributing and Measuring Your Video's Impact

Creating the video is only half the work; distribution determines its ROI. The most effective channels for B2B case study videos are company landing pages, LinkedIn posts, and email marketing sequences.

Embedding a video on a product page can directly influence purchase decisions. On LinkedIn, native video posts receive 5x more engagement than other content types (LinkedIn official data, 2026).

When sharing, track key performance indicators (KPIs) to measure success. The most important metrics are not views, but viewer engagement and conversion.

Focus on:

  • View-Through Rate (VTR): The percentage of viewers who watched the entire video. A VTR above 50% is considered strong for a 90-second B2B video.
  • Click-Through Rate (CTR): The percentage of viewers who clicked the call-to-action link.
  • Conversion Rate: The percentage of viewers who completed the desired action, like booking a demo.

How long should a business case study video be?

The ideal length for a business case study video is 60 to 90 seconds. According to a 2026 Vidyard report on B2B video, engagement drops significantly after the 90-second mark. This length is sufficient to present the client's problem, your solution, and the quantifiable results without losing the viewer's attention.

For social media platforms like LinkedIn, shorter is better.

What's a common mistake in AI case study videos?

A common mistake is forgetting to include on-screen text callouts for key data points. While the voiceover mentions the results (e.g., "a 40% increase in revenue"), displaying that number as large text on screen for 2-3 seconds makes it much more memorable. Viewers often skim or watch with low volume, and these text highlights ensure the most important results are not missed.
